This WMW is a CNC milling machine — sometimes referred to as a machining centre — designed for precision metal cutting, contouring, and surface milling across a wide range of workpiece sizes. WMW, the German industrial machinery group with roots in East German manufacturing, has a long history of producing machine tools for metalworking and engineering industries.
The machine offers a longitudinal X-axis travel of 1,400 mm, a cross travel on the Y-axis of 630 mm, and a vertical Z-axis travel of 500 mm, giving it a substantial working envelope suited to medium and large components. The table measures 1,800 × 630 mm, providing ample clamping area for sizeable or elongated workpieces. The milling head accepts ISO 50 tooling, a robust taper standard widely used in heavy-duty milling applications, which ensures compatibility with a broad selection of commercially available cutting tools and toolholders.
Control is handled by a Heidenhain iTNC 530, a conversational CNC system well regarded in the industry for its intuitive programming interface, high-precision interpolation, and suitability for complex 3D contouring work.
